Question 1- Which nutrient deficiency causes thyroid in women? 

Answer 1- Iodine deficiency can also cause thyroid problems. Iodine is very important for thyroid function. The thyroid gland needs iodine to make thyroid hormones. Too little iodine can cause hypothyroidism. Apart from iodine, deficiency of zinc, selenium, iron and vitamin D can also cause thyroid problems.
